
In Mirdif, kitchen renovation delays can extend a project's timeline by several weeks or even months. Common causes include permit approval holdups with Dubai Municipality, late material deliveries to the area, and contractor scheduling conflicts. For a typical villa renovation, a two-week material delay often cascades, pushing plumbing, electrical, and final installation phases back sequentially. This is especially disruptive in family-oriented communities like Mirdif, where residents heavily on their kitchen. Proactive planning and buffer time are essential. To mitigate timeline impacts from delays in your Mirdif kitchen remodel, build a 15-20% time buffer into your initial schedule. Secure all Dubai Municipality approvals before demolition begins. Source materials from suppliers with a strong track record of delivering to Mirdif and surrounding areas like Al Warqa'a. Confirm your contractor's current workload to avoid being sidelined for another project. Daily communication with your foreman is key to catching small delays before they become major setbacks, helping keep your family's disruption to a minimum.

Delays directly increase the overall cost and timeline of a Mirdif kitchen renovation. Beyond extended labor fees, you may face additional expenses for temporary kitchen setups or extended dining out. Storage costs for delivered appliances and cabinets can also accrue if installation is postponed. When comparing contractors, scrutinize their proposed timelines and ask for specific examples of recent projects completed in Mirdif villas or apartments. A slightly higher quote from a more reliable team often proves cheaper than the hidden costs of a delayed, budget contractor.

Mirdif's specific context influences delay impacts. Many villas here are older, so contractors often uncover unexpected structural or wiring issues once walls are opened, requiring immediate—and time-consuming—remediation. Furthermore, the community's strict rules on hours, waste disposal, and contractor parking can slow daily progress. Families should prepare for significant daily disruption; consider arranging alternative meal prep spaces. For temporary solutions, some residents use community clubhouse facilities or rent short-term kitchen pods, which are services increasingly available in Dubai.
